OCPDs must be readily accessible [240.24 (A)]. Install them so the center of the grip of the operating handle, when in its highest position, isn’t more than 6 ft, 7 in. above the floor or working platform. Exceptions exist in 240.21 (A) through (G). Here's a summary of each of these, but be sure to read the details if the exception applies to your situation. (A) Branch circuits meeting 210.19 requirements are exempted from 240.21 location requirements. Examples include multiwire and range circuits.

240.21(B)(1) Feeder Taps Not over 3 m (10 ft) Long. Click to Enlarge The tap conductor ampacity cannot be less than the rating of the equipment containing an overcurrent device supplied by the tap conductors or not less than the rating of the overcurrent protective device at the termination of the tap conductors. 240.21(B) Feeder Taps. Conductors shall be permitted to be tapped, without overcurrent protection at the tap, to a feeder as specified in 240.21(B)(1) through (B)(5).

Code reference: 240.21 NEC 240.21 “Location in Circuit” requires an overcurrent protective device “at the point where the conductors receive their supply”. NEC 240.21(C) allows the omission of overcurrent protection at the secondary of the transformer if the rules in 240.21(C)(1) through (C)(6) are followed.

NEC 430.53 (D) addresses the conductor sizes used in group motor installations and is the starting point for compliance. It applies in all cases for all group motor installations.
